Latest Patents

Nathan Jackson holds a patent for a "Monolithic integrated mesh device for fluid dispensers and method of making same." This invention provides a monolithic integrated mesh device for atomization or pumping of a fluid or liquid, comprising a plurality of apertures and a piezoelectric material. The piezoelectric material is bonded to the mesh device at an atomic scale. In one embodiment, the monolithic micro-fabricated device includes piezoelectric material that eliminates the need for expensive assembly processes and improves reliability. This innovation also has the advantage of requiring lower operating voltage and less complicated circuitry.
